Police today claimed to have busted a gang of car thieves by arresting two culprits and recovering over a dozen stolen vehicles at their instance here.
Mohammad Asif Wani of Gurez in Bandipora district and Bashiq Bhat of Puhroo-Sarnal in Anantnag were apprehended by a special team, which was formed after an organised group of car lifters took advantage of massive floods in September last and succeeded in stealing cars from and around north zone of Srinagar city, a police spokesman said.
He said the duo were residing at Namchibal in downtown and Budshah Nagar in uptown city and had lifted 14 cars - seven in the jurisdiction of police station Maharaj Gunj, four in Safakadal, two in Khanyar and one in Rainawari.
The special team headed by a sub-divisional police officer (SDPO) succeeded in unearthing the module, the spokesman said, adding all the stolen cars were recovered at the instance of the arrested persons.
